Historical romance is my guilty pleasure, and I've devoured enough books to know the publishers who consistently deliver the steam. Avon has been the gold standard for decades, with their 'Avon Romance' imprint practically defining the genre. They publish authors like Julia Quinn and Lisa Kleypas, whose books blend historical detail with sizzling chemistry. I love how their covers balance elegance with just enough hint of passion to make you blush in public.
Kensington Books is another heavyweight, especially with their 'Zebra' line. They take more risks with tropes and settings, offering everything from Regency rakehells to Highland warriors. Their steamy scenes often push boundaries while maintaining historical authenticity. St. Martin's Press deserves mention too—their 'Griffin' imprint has released some of the most emotionally charged historical romances I've read, where the heat feels earned through deep character development.
Smaller presses like Sourcebooks Casablanca and Entangled Publishing (their 'Scandalous' historical line) are rising stars. They nurture newer voices while keeping the steam levels high. I appreciate how Entangled often blends mystery or suspense into their romances, adding layers to the tension. For indie publishers, Tule Publishing's 'English Tea Garden' series proves you don't need a big name to craft atmospheric, passionate stories that stick with you.
